def __import__(*args, **kwargs):
"""
__import__(name, globals=None, locals=None, fromlist=(), level=0) -> object
Normally python protects imports against concurrency by doing some locking
at the C level (at least, it does that in CPython). This function just
wraps the normal __import__ functionality in a recursive lock, ensuring that
we're protected against greenlet import concurrency as well.
"""
if len(args) > 0 and not issubclass(type(args[0]), _allowed_module_name_types):
# if a builtin has been acquired as a bound instance method,
# python knows not to pass 'self' when the method is called.
# No such protection exists for monkey-patched builtins,
# however, so this is necessary.
args = args[1:]
if not __lock_imports:
return _import(*args, **kwargs)
module_lock = __module_lock(args[0]) # Get a lock for the module name
imp.acquire_lock()
try:
module_lock.acquire()
try:
result = _import(*args, **kwargs)
finally:
module_lock.release()
finally:
imp.release_lock()
return result
